Key Practices for Regular GPU Maintenance

  • Regular Cleaning: Dust and debris can accumulate on heatsinks and fans, impairing cooling. Use compressed air to clean your GPU periodically.
  • Update Drivers: Keeping your GPU drivers up to date ensures optimal compatibility and performance with the latest software and games.
  • Monitor Temperatures: Use software tools to keep an eye on GPU temperatures. High temperatures may indicate cooling issues that need addressing.
  • Optimize Settings: Adjust in-game or application settings to balance performance and quality, reducing unnecessary strain on the GPU.
  • Improve Cooling Solutions: Consider aftermarket cooling options or improve airflow within your PC case for better heat dissipation.
